When working but if I try to add a BNO080 (Adafruit or Sparkfun) it reboots the ESP32S3 and seems to hang. No error messages

Description

Using a I2c test board that we used for testing the Teens 4.1:
Image_20220406_092212

I attached the ESP32S3. All worked well until I tried to add the BNO080 to either I2c or I2c1 bus (Arduino verbiage Wire or Wire1). When I add the BNO080 it reboots the ESP32S3 and seems to hang Mu edit and I have to power cycle to get it running again. No error messages appear.

If I run the same script using CircuitPython on the T4.1 it picks up all devices including the BNO080. I do have a QT PY RP204 on order to test it with that as well.
